Synthesis of 1-azobenzene-3-(5-cyano-2-pyridyl)-triazene and Its Color Reaction with Copper

Abstract

1-azobenzene-3-(5-cyano -2-pyridyl)-triazene (ABCPDT)as a chromogenic reagent was synthesized and its color reaction with copper has been investigated. In the presence of the surface active agent NP-10 and in the Na 2B 4O 7-NaOH medium of pH 11.0, ABCPDT forms a red complex with Cu(Ⅱ).The apparent molar absorbtivity of the complex is 1.43×10 5 L·mol -1 ·cm -1 at 535 nm(λ max ).The molar ratio of Cu(Ⅱ) to ABCPDT is 1∶3. Beer's law is well obeyed in the range of 0~480 μg/L for copper. The method has been applied to the direct determination of copper in alloy samples with satisfactory results.
